Over 80% of human proteins evade conventional drug discovery approaches due to their structural complexity. We have developed hydrogel-encapsulated magnetic beads that can convert solution-phase libraries into FACS-compatible one-bead-one-compound formats via bulk emulsion polymerization and in-gel functionalization. My work established both activity-based aptamer screening and cellular phenotypic assays, enabling functional discovery beyond binding measurements. Together, these advances create a scalable pipeline for high-throughput functional and cellular screening in drug discovery.
